Went out to see my chickens today, and found one of my three year old self-blue cochin bantam hens with weird black stuff in her feathers.
The best way I can describe it is like if you have a fake leather couch or chair, and it gets old and eventually the leather veneer starts flaking off and it winds up in little tiny pieces all over the house.

The black stuff does not appear to be bugs. I can't see any legs or movement, and if I squish the stuff it seems flat already. No blood comes out, and the stuff itself is not blood either (like how "flea dirt" leaves dark clumps but when you wet them they melt back into blood). Her skin is clear. No bugs or bites on it.

She is molting currently, and some of the new feathers look like they have this black stuff coming from inside them. I can't prove it's not something that latched onto the growing in feathers, but it really seems to be coming from inside. If you really soak the stuff and let it sit, it gives the water a gray pigment. She is a gray chicken, so I'm wondering if she just has some feathers that aren't forming right and this clumpy stuff is just feather material.

I found a few feathers where there is literally just the shaft (fishing line-like center stalk) with tons of the black clumpy stuff on it.
